Lil Wayne Declares Jay-Z Should Be The Rapper To Run For President

Tunechi presents an early endorsement for the Carter campaign.

(AllHipHop News) Dwayne “Lil Wayne” Carter has never been shy about showcasing the fact he is a huge fan of Shawn “Jay-Z” Carter. The Young Money boss even has Hov’s “Lucky Me” lyrics tattooed on his body.

So it comes as no surprise that if Wayne had to pick one emcee to seek the highest office in the land, the choice would be his “Mr. Carter” and “Hello Brooklyn 2.0” collaborator. Weezy was asked about a potential Hip Hop POTUS during a conversation for “The Bumbu Room” interview series.

“If there was a rapper that should ever run for president, I believe that rapper should easily be Jay-Z,” declared Lil Wayne. “I don’t even think there’s a ‘why’ that should come after that. Plain and simple. I would love to see [Beyoncé] as the First Lady… another Carter in the White House.”

Jay-Z has never publicly expressed interest in possibly following in the footsteps of U.S. Presidents such as Jimmy Carter, Ronald Reagan, Bill Clinton, and George W. Bush. However, the Roc Nation founder did endorse Barack Obama in 2008 and 2012 as well as Hillary Clinton in 2016. He has also been an outspoken critic of the current Commander-in-Chief Donald Trump.
